The Story
A single mom posted that she had a job, but due to recent illness and medical bills she could not afford groceries until her next paycheck. We met at a grocery store and purchased groceries for her and her children.
A caretaker who needed to be out of town for a week needed meals provided for her grandfather. Several people cooked meals and met the lady at public locations to pick up meals before leaving town.
A mother and daughter needed a ride home after a lengthy hospital stay.
The idea for providing this platform is not original.
It came from the occasional thread on groups that people create for the same purpose of meeting needs.
It became a passion to create a space for service projects that are accessible to anyone, whether you are in need or want to meet a need for someone.
In Matthew 9:35-36 Jesus was going to towns and villages teaching and healing, and verse 36 says, “When He saw the crowds, He had compassion on them because they were confused and helpless, like sheep without a shepherd.” This scripture is the heart of Kind in the 409, being moved with compassion for people, and to see lives changed.
This is a place where we can put scripture into action. Jesus instructed us to give freely what we have received, to ANYONE who asks, to those who could not repay, and even to test Him in our giving. (Luke 6:30, 14:13-14, Matthew 10:8, Malachi 3:10-12)
